Connor McCaffery (born July 13, 1998) is an former American basketball guard who is a team assistant for the Indiana Pacers of the National Basketball Association (NBA). He played college basketball at Iowa.

Early life and high school[edit]

McCaffery was born in South Bend, Indiana, where his father, Fran Fran McCaffery was an assistant basketball coach at Notre Dame, while his mother, Margaret attended law school. He spent his early childhood there until moving to North Carolina and later to Albany, New York after Fran became the head coach at Siena. He moved with his family to Iowa City, Iowa at age ten when his father was named the head coach at the University of Iowa. College career[edit]

McCaffery also played on Iowa's baseball team as a first baseman, left fielder, and right fielder during their 2018 and 2019 seasons. Due to only playing 22 games in the 2 seasons combined, he quit baseball because of injuries and health issues.[1]

Personal life[edit]

McCaffery began dating former Iowa women's basketball and Indiana Fever guard Caitlin Clark in April 2023.[1] His father Fran has coached men's basketball at Lehigh, UNC Greensboro, and Siena, and currently coaches at Iowa.[1]
